1970 Daihatsu Compagno vs. 1982 Ford Thunderbird

To start off, 1982 Ford Thunderbird is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1970 Daihatsu Compagno.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1970 Daihatsu Compagno would be higher. At 4,186 cc (8 cylinders), 1982 Ford Thunderbird is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1982 Ford Thunderbird (111 HP @ 3400 RPM) has 76 more horse power than 1970 Daihatsu Compagno. (35 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1982 Ford Thunderbird should accelerate faster than 1970 Daihatsu Compagno.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1982 Ford Thunderbird weights approximately 787 kg more than 1970 Daihatsu Compagno.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1982 Ford Thunderbird (264 Nm @ 1600 RPM) has 198 more torque (in Nm) than 1970 Daihatsu Compagno. (66 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1982 Ford Thunderbird will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1970 Daihatsu Compagno.

Compare all specifications:

1970 Daihatsu Compagno 1982 Ford Thunderbird
Make Daihatsu Ford
Model Compagno Thunderbird
Year Released 1970 1982
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 797 cc 4186 cc
Horse Power 35 HP 111 HP
Engine RPM 5000 RPM 3400 RPM
Torque 66 Nm 264 Nm
Torque RPM 3600 RPM 1600 RPM
Drive Type Rear Rear
Vehicle Weight 790 kg 1577 kg
Vehicle Length 3800 mm 5100 mm
Vehicle Width 1450 mm 1890 mm
Vehicle Height 1360 mm 1350 mm
Wheelbase Size 2230 mm 2760 mm
